In 2016, Hopkins, McConville, and Propp proved that labeled chip-firing on a line always leaves the chips in sorted order provided that the initial number of chips is even. We present a novel proof of this result. We then apply our methods to resolve a number of related conjectures concerning the confluence of labeled chip-firing systems. (c) 2021 Elsevier Inc.
